Items are incorrectly dropped from inventory when tapping on them.

      A bug with the inventory screen is causing items to drop out of the inventory. When interacting with items in the inventory screen, the expected behavior is that tapping on an item will highlight it with a thicker border. This item can then be moved to a different spot in the inventory or to a chest by tapping on the designated square. Items can also swap locations in this manner. Items should only be dropped from the inventory screen when tapping outside the inventory area with an item selected. 

      The current behavior is that when any item is tapped on in the inventory screen (in the hotbar, inventory or chest) the item will be dropped out of the inventory. As a result, rearranging the inventory to one's liking is very difficult. This also results in the game being very difficult to play since items can't be moved into chests. 
      This issue was encountered on an iPhone 15 Pro Max running on iOS 17.1 on the latest public release of Minecraft. No resource or behavior packs were in use when this bug was encountered.
